The Importance of Burning Belly Fat
Why Target Belly Fat?
Belly fat, also known as visceral fat, can lead to serious health risks, including heart disease, diabetes, and high blood pressure. Unlike subcutaneous fat, which lies just beneath the skin, visceral fat is stored deep inside the abdomen, surrounding vital organs. Regular physical activity, paired with healthy eating, is crucial to losing belly fat and maintaining a healthy lifestyle.

9 Effective Belly Fat Burning Exercises You Can Do at Home
1. Mountain Climbers
How to Perform Mountain Climbers
Mountain climbers are a dynamic full-body exercise that targets your core, shoulders, arms, and legs, with a focus on the abdominal area. Here’s how to do it:
- Start in a high plank position with your hands under your shoulders, legs extended behind you, and your body in a straight line from head to heels.
- Bring your right knee towards your chest while keeping your left leg extended.
- Quickly switch legs, bringing your left knee toward your chest while extending your right leg back.
- Continue alternating legs at a fast pace, as if you’re “climbing” a mountain.
Benefits
Mountain climbers are a great cardiovascular exercise that raises your heart rate, promoting fat burning. They engage multiple muscle groups and effectively work your abdominal muscles, helping to tone and tighten your belly.
2. Plank with Knee Tuck
How to Perform Plank with Knee Tuck
The plank with knee tuck is an excellent exercise for targeting the core, particularly the lower abdominal area. Here’s how to do it:
- Start in a forearm plank position, with your elbows aligned beneath your shoulders and your body in a straight line.
- Slowly pull your right knee towards your chest, keeping your core engaged.
- Extend your right leg back to the starting position.
- Repeat the movement with your left leg.
- Continue alternating legs, performing the knee tuck slowly and with control.
Benefits
This variation of the plank engages the core muscles while also working the shoulders and glutes. The knee tuck emphasizes the lower abs and promotes fat loss around the belly.
3. Bicycle Crunches
How to Perform Bicycle Crunches
Bicycle crunches are one of the most effective exercises for targeting the obliques and the rectus abdominis, helping to sculpt the entire abdominal region. Follow these steps:
- Lie on your back with your knees bent and hands behind your head.
- Lift your head, neck, and shoulders off the floor and bring your right elbow toward your left knee while extending your right leg straight.
- Straighten your left leg while twisting your torso to the left, bringing your left elbow towards your right knee.
- Continue alternating sides, engaging your core throughout the movement.
- Benefits
- Bicycle crunches are great for toning the abs and engaging the obliques, which are essential for creating a well-defined midsection. This exercise also improves overall core strength and stability.
4. Leg Raises
How to Perform Leg Raises
Leg raises focus on the lower abdomen and help to reduce belly fat by targeting the muscles in your lower stomach. Here’s how to do it:
- Lie flat on your back with your legs straight and your arms at your sides.
- Slowly raise your legs towards the ceiling, keeping them straight and together.
- Lower your legs back down without letting them touch the ground, then raise them again.
- Repeat for a set of repetitions.
Benefits
Leg raises specifically target the lower part of your abdominal muscles, a common area where belly fat tends to accumulate. This exercise helps to build a leaner, more toned lower abdomen.
5. Russian Twists
How to Perform Russian Twists
Russian twists are an excellent exercise for engaging the obliques and building rotational strength in your core. To perform them:
- Sit on the floor with your knees bent and feet flat.
- Lean back slightly while keeping your spine straight and your core engaged.
- Clasp your hands together in front of you or hold a weight for added resistance.
- Rotate your torso to the right, bringing your hands to the side of your body.
- Twist to the left and return to the center.
- Repeat the movement, alternating sides.
Benefits
Russian twists work your obliques and entire core, which helps to tone the sides of your abdomen and promote overall fat loss. This exercise also improves your balance and coordination.
6. High Knees
How to Perform High Knees
High knees are a great cardio exercise that increases your heart rate and targets your core, legs, and hips. Here’s how to do it:
- Stand with your feet hip-width apart and engage your core.
- Begin by running in place, bringing your knees up towards your chest as high as possible.
- Pump your arms as you alternate lifting each knee.
- Maintain a fast pace for a set period of time, such as 30 seconds to one minute.
Benefits
High knees are an excellent cardiovascular exercise that helps burn calories, which is key to reducing overall body fat. They also engage the core and lower body, providing a full-body workout.
7. Burpees
How to Perform Burpees
Burpees are a full-body exercise that targets multiple muscle groups, including the core, chest, and legs. Here’s how to do it:
- Stand with your feet shoulder-width apart.
- Squat down and place your hands on the floor, jumping your feet back into a plank position.
- Perform a push-up, then jump your feet back toward your hands.
- Explode upwards into a jump, reaching for the sky.
- Land softly and repeat the movement.
Benefits
Burpees are intense and effective for burning belly fat, as they work the entire body while elevating your heart rate. The explosive movement and full-body engagement contribute to fat loss and overall fitness.
8. Jumping Jacks
How to Perform Jumping Jacks
Jumping jacks are a simple yet highly effective cardio exercise that gets your heart pumping and helps to burn fat. To perform:
- Stand with your feet together and arms by your sides.
- Jump your feet out wide while raising your arms overhead.
- Jump back to the starting position with your feet together and arms by your sides.
- Continue jumping at a steady pace for a set amount of time.
Benefits
Jumping jacks are a great full-body exercise that increases calorie burn, contributing to fat loss. The quick, repetitive movement helps to burn calories, including belly fat.
9. Squats
How to Perform Squats
Squats are a powerful exercise that targets the lower body and core while helping to burn belly fat. Here’s how to do it:
- Stand with your feet shoulder-width apart and your toes pointing slightly outward.
- Lower your body into a squat position by bending your knees and pushing your hips back.
- Keep your chest lifted and your knees aligned with your toes.
- Press through your heels to stand back up, squeezing your glutes as you rise.
- Repeat for a set of repetitions.
Benefits
While squats primarily target the legs and glutes, they also engage the core. By incorporating squats into your routine, you’ll increase muscle mass, which boosts your metabolism and aids in fat burning.
